Transaction 8cc34ca8324c72393cd69e9ebe2af6b3f9f6ac88a76414403fb55e3c7900205a
1 Input
1 Output
-
8cc34ca8324c72393cd69e9ebe2af6b3f9f6ac88a76414403fb55e3c7900205a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 06e992b94a54b46e53ed8113d6403a3f4554b4fab567cf938a5f964ff899ecea
- address
- bc1pqm5e9w222j6xu5ldsyfavsp68az4fd86k4nulyu2t7tyl7yean4qmacjex